Program Overview
The Medical Assistant program spans 630 hours, divided into 430 hours of lectures and labs and 200 hours of externship experience. Classes are held from 8:00 AM to 4:00 PM, Monday through Thursday, with occasional Friday sessions scheduled in advance. The program is structured to teach both administrative and clinical skills necessary for entry-level roles in healthcare.
Upon completion, students can sit for the NHA CCMA national examination, which is administered on-site, with the first exam attempt covered by the school. Graduates are equipped to perform various tasks, from patient care to medical office administration, making them versatile professionals in today’s medical field.
Curriculum Details
The curriculum is divided into ten modules, each focusing on essential skills and knowledge areas:
- MA-101: Introduction to Medical Assisting as a Career
- MA-102: Safety, Infection Control, and Clinical Practice
- MA-103: Effective Communication Skills
- MA-104: Medical Terminology
- MA-105: Anatomy and Physiology
- MA-106: Phlebotomy and EKG Basics
- MA-107: Assisting in Therapeutics
- MA-108: Administrative Practices
- MA-109: NHA Certification Preparation
- MA-110: Externship
Students gain proficiency in tasks such as taking vital signs, managing medical records, performing non-invasive procedures, and preparing patients for examinations. Administrative skills include billing, coding, and arranging laboratory services.
Cost Breakdown
The total estimated cost for the program is $11,995, broken down as follows:
- Tuition: $10,500
- Registration Fee: $35
- Books and Supplies: $810
- Laboratory Fee: $650
This competitive pricing is among the lowest in the region, and the institute provides several options to ease the financial burden, including payment plans, federal and state financial aid, and grants through Workforce Solutions Alamo for eligible students.

Prerequisites
To enroll in the Medical Assistant program, applicants must meet the following requirements:
- Government-issued photo ID
- Proof of high school completion or GED
- Social Security card
- Pass a background check
- Be at least 18 years old
